Hon. Marc Gold (Government Representative in the Senate): Senator, thank you for your question. As we all know, Canada imposes sanctions under the Special Economic Measures Act and the Sergei Magnitsky Law, which the government passed in 2017. It’s my understanding that the government created a new sanctions bureau, and that Canada is the first of our allies to make use of new seizure and forfeiture authorities. I remind the chamber that the government has also imposed sanctions that have been adopted by the UN Security Council, and, as we all know, the enforcement of this Canada sanctions regime is the responsibility of the RCMP and the Canada Border Services Agency. Canada remains committed to enforcing its laws appropriately in light of the Russian aggression in Ukraine.
